The role in a nutshell:
To help plan and deliver a schedule of social activities throughout Cumberland and Eden, through Age UK North Cumbria and/or partner organisations.What will you be doing?
To establish, maintain and develop relationships with clients attending activities.
- To be involved with the planning and implementation of activities, i.e., games, quizzes etc.
- To adhere to all policies and procedures of Age UK North Cumbria including Health and Safety, Safeguarding, Confidentiality, and Lone working.
- Participating in catch-ups and support sessions as required.
- Working as part of a team and with other Age UK North Cumbria staff and volunteers.
How would you be supported in this role?
> Training provided, including
- Health & Safety
- Age UK North Cumbria Policies
> Ongoing support & supervision by service managers
> Invited to volunteering events and social events arranged by Age UK North Cumbria.

What skills, interests or experience might be helpful in this role?
A liking for and empathy with older people.
- Ability to work as part of a team.
- Good listening and communication skills.
- Good timekeeping skills.
- Reliability and trustworthiness.
- An interest in developing activities for older people.
- An understanding of the need for confidentiality.
